The model is original, the textures are not. I took them from NFS3, in all their 64x64 pixel glory. The track shape is roughly based off of Redrock Ridge from said game, but I decided against replicating it. Many features from the original map are here, such as the tall rock formation, the tunnels, the train overpass, and the rock outcroppings in the middle of the road. And instead of teh large satellite dish, there's gonna be the pictured forerunner structure. The bitmaps on that were taken from a Halo 2 texture pack on this site. I made custom bumpmaps for it using the free program "Crazy Bump".
Also I intend on making the road a little more varying in the height department, and also count on there being custom road signs.
